[发明专利]文件存储方法、文件读取方法及装置有效
申请号: | 202210367822.8 | 申请日: | 2022-04-08 |
公开(公告)号: | CN114968088B | 公开(公告)日: | 2023-09-05 |
发明(设计)人: | 黄健文;朱林;陈芨;丁奕;陈秋华;廖志芳;苏丽裕;董钟豪;文智 | 申请(专利权)人: | 中移互联网有限公司;中国移动通信集团有限公司 |
主分类号: | G06F3/06 | 分类号: | G06F3/06;G06F21/60;G06F21/62 |
代理公司: | 北京国昊天诚知识产权代理有限公司 11315 | 代理人: | 王思超 |
地址: | 510000 广东省广*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 文件 存储 方法 读取 装置 | ||
本申请实施例提供了一种文件存储方法、文件读取方法及装置,该文件存储方法包括:根据目标文件的文件类型生成目标文件的虚拟存储地址,文件类型与虚拟存储地址相对应;基于虚拟存储地址中的标识符将虚拟存储地址进行拆分,得到多个虚拟存储地址段;对各虚拟存储地址段分别进行加密,打包生成虚拟存储地址加密包;将虚拟存储地址加密包的加密信息分配至目标用户,通过目标用户对目标文件进行存储,生成与虚拟存储地址对应的真实存储地址。
技术领域
本申请涉及信息安全技术领域,尤其涉及一种文件存储方法、文件读取方法及装置。
背景技术
随着信息技术的不断发展,终端设备为用户带来便利的同时,终端设备中信息的安全问题也日益增多。
在一些场景下,终端设备直接存储在终端设备的系统盘中,并以文件夹的形式向用户展示,文件夹中对应存储至少一个文件,当用户访问终端设备中的这些文件时,用户完成简单验证后,直接从终端设备的真实存储地址中读取这些文件,如验证方式可以为密码验证、指纹验证等。当访问终端设备的密码恶意被破解后,非法用户很容易就能读取到这些文件,因此,文件的安全性较低,用户数据可能会被泄露。
发明内容
本申请实施例的目的是提供一种文件存储方法、文件读取方法及装置,能够提高文件的安全性,避免用户数据泄露。
为了解决上述技术问题,本申请实施例是这样实现的:
第一方面,本申请实施例提供了一种文件存储方法,包括:根据目标文件的文件类型生成所述目标文件的虚拟存储地址,所述文件类型与所述虚拟存储地址相对应;基于所述虚拟存储地址中的标识符将所述虚拟存储地址进行拆分,得到多个虚拟存储地址段;对各所述虚拟存储地址段分别进行加密,打包生成虚拟存储地址加密包;将所述虚拟存储地址加密包的加密信息分配至目标用户,通过所述目标用户对所述目标文件进行存储,生成所述目标文件的真实存储地址,所述虚拟存储地址和所述真实存储地址相对应,且所述真实存储地址与所述虚拟存储地址不同。
第二方面,本申请实施例提供了一种文件读取方法,包括:接收第一用户针对目标文件的读取请求,所述读取请求中携带所述目标文件的虚拟存储地址加密包的解密信息;在接收到第一目标用户针对所述解密信息的确认操作后,将所述目标文件的真实存储地址发送至所述第一用户,以使所述第一用户从所述真实存储地址中读取所述目标文件。
第三方面,本申请实施例提供了一种文件存储装置,包括:生成模块,用于根据目标文件的文件类型生成所述目标文件的虚拟存储地址,所述文件类型与所述虚拟存储地址相对应;拆分模块,用于基于所述虚拟存储地址中的标识符将所述虚拟存储地址进行拆分,得到多个虚拟存储地址段;加密模块,用于对各所述虚拟存储地址段分别进行加密,打包生成虚拟存储地址加密包;存储模块,用于将所述虚拟存储地址加密包的加密信息分配至目标用户,通过所述目标用户对所述目标文件进行存储,生成所述目标文件的真实存储地址,所述虚拟存储地址和所述真实存储地址相对应,且所述真实存储地址与所述虚拟存储地址不同。
第四方面,本申请实施例提供了一种文件读取装置,包括:接收模块,用于接收第一用户针对目标文件的读取请求,所述读取请求中携带所述目标文件的虚拟存储地址加密包的解密信息;读取模块,用于在接收到第一目标用户针对所述解密信息的确认操作后,将所述目标文件的真实存储地址发送至所述第一用户,以使所述第一用户从所述真实存储地址中读取所述目标文件。
第五方面,本申请实施例提供了一种电子设备,包括处理器、通信接口、存储器和通信总线;其中,所述处理器、所述通信接口以及所述存储器通过通信总线完成相互间的通信;所述存储器,用于存放计算机程序;所述处理器,用于执行所述存储器上所存放的程序,实现如第一方面所提到的文件存储方法或第二方面所提到的文件读取方法的步骤。
第六方面,本申请实施例提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有计算机程序,所述计算机程序被处理器执行时,实现如第一方面所提到的文件存储方法或第二方面所提到的文件读取方法步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中移互联网有限公司;中国移动通信集团有限公司,未经中移互联网有限公司;中国移动通信集团有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210367822.8/2.html,转载请声明来源钻瓜专利网。